	At a first guess wouldn't +:*::::0:0::: include everyone with
	a password of '*'?

	Does a 'cd ~user' work for a user taken from the NIS passwd file?

On Wed, 13 Jun 2001, Fredrik Bjurenfors wrote:

> Im trying to get NIS working.
> The NIS server is a Debian GNU/Linux machine (sid)
> The Client is a NetBSD 1.5 machine (not working)
> I have a working GNU/Linux client.
>
>
> On the netbsd client:
> I can do ypcat passwd and i get all accounts that is avaible.
>
> This is what the passwd looks like:
> +:*::::0:0:::
>
> /etc/group has till on the end:
> +:::
>
> I tried this in /etc/nsswitch.conf
> passwd:                files nis
> group:         files nis
> That didnt work
>
> I tried
> passwd:                nis [notfound=return] files
> group:         nis [notfound=return] files
> Didnt work either.
>
>
> Other entrys looks like this:
> group:          compat
> group_compat:   nis
> hosts:          files dns
> netgroup:       files [notfound=return] nis
> networks:       files
> passwd:         compat
> passwd_compat:  nis
> shells:         files
>
>
> The domainname is set to the right nis domainname.
>
> rc.conf has this:
> rpcbind=YES
> ypbind=YES
>
> I have do a ypinit -c
>
> The NIS server is in /etc/hosts
>
> /etc/resolv.conf has on top:
> lookup yp dns
>
> I can su from root to other nis-users.
>
> ypwhich gives me the right output.
>
> I guess that this problem has something to do with the passwords or their
> cryptmethod.
